MFIC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review

129 of the 6,340 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in MidCap Financial Investment (MFIC)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$255M — up 0.03% from $255M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 21 funds opened new MFIC positions and 20 closed out — a net gain of 1 holder — while 43 added to existing stakes and 33 trimmed.

The largest buyer was VanEck Associates, adding an estimated $6.64M.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$3.4M.
